Design of digital sampling impedance bridge for battery impedance spectroscopy
Description
The paper describes the design of a digital sampling impedance bridge dedicated for battery impedance spectroscopy, which has been presented at the 24th IMEKO TC4 International Symposium and has been published afterwards as an extended, peer reviewed paper by IMEKO. It suggests topologies capable of measurement of sub-milliohm impedances in full complex plane. The paper also shows measurement uncertainty contributions of the digitizer nonlinearity and coaxial network of the bridge including parasitic inductive and capacitive couplings in the network. Combined uncertainty of the bridge with common NI 9238 digitizer ranges from less than 20 μW/W to order of 0.01% for voltage drop above 1mV at the measured standard in a frequency range 0.01 Hz to 5 kHz. Angular errors can be as low as 1 μrad for frequencies below 1 kHz when measured voltage drops exceed 10mV. The paper also presents experimental measurements showing capability to measure low impedances from 0.01 Hz to 5 kHz.
